示例#1
0
文件: helpers.py 项目: lkilcher/pint
def requires_python3():
    return unittest.skipUnless(PYTHON3, 'Requires Python 3.X.')
示例#2
0
文件: helpers.py 项目: lkilcher/pint
def requires_numpy18():
    if not HAS_NUMPY:
        return unittest.skip('Requires NumPy')
    return unittest.skipUnless(
        StrictVersion(NUMPY_VER) >= StrictVersion('1.8'),
        'Requires NumPy >= 1.8')
示例#3
0
文件: helpers.py 项目: lkilcher/pint
def requires_numpy():
    return unittest.skipUnless(HAS_NUMPY, 'Requires NumPy')
示例#4
0
文件: helpers.py 项目: lkilcher/pint
def requires_uncertainties():
    return unittest.skipUnless(HAS_UNCERTAINTIES, 'Requires Uncertainties')
示例#5
0
文件: helpers.py 项目: steveb/pint
def requires_numpy18():
    return unittest.skipUnless(NUMPY_VER >= '1.8', 'Requires NumPy >= 1.8')
示例#6
0
文件: helpers.py 项目: lkilcher/pint
def requires_numpy_previous_than(version):
    if not HAS_NUMPY:
        return unittest.skip('Requires NumPy')
    return unittest.skipUnless(
        StrictVersion(NUMPY_VER) < StrictVersion(version),
        'Requires NumPy < %s' % version)
示例#7
0
def requires_python3():
    return unittest.skipUnless(PYTHON3, 'Requires Python 3.X.')
示例#8
0
def requires_uncertainties():
    return unittest.skipUnless(HAS_UNCERTAINTIES, 'Requires Uncertainties')
示例#9
0
def requires_numpy():
    return unittest.skipUnless(HAS_NUMPY, 'Requires NumPy')
示例#10
0
文件: helpers.py 项目: lkilcher/pint
def requires_numpy18():
    if not HAS_NUMPY:
        return unittest.skip('Requires NumPy')
    return unittest.skipUnless(StrictVersion(NUMPY_VER) >= StrictVersion('1.8'), 'Requires NumPy >= 1.8')
示例#11
0
文件: helpers.py 项目: lkilcher/pint
def requires_numpy_previous_than(version):
    if not HAS_NUMPY:
        return unittest.skip('Requires NumPy')
    return unittest.skipUnless(StrictVersion(NUMPY_VER) < StrictVersion(version), 'Requires NumPy < %s' % version)